- Created a new sitemap.xml file for better SEO. - Added a compressed version of the sitemap as sitemap.xml.gz. - Introduced extra.css for custom styles, including Persian font support (IRANSansX). - Defined font-face rules for regular and bold styles of IRANSansX. - Implemented various text styles and layout adjustments for better readability. - Enhanced Mermaid diagram styles to support Persian text rendering.
3.2 KiB
درسنامه ۸: مستندات دستورات و یادگیری عمیق در لینوکس
صفحات راهنما با man
دستور man (Manual) مرجع اصلی برای مطالعهٔ جزئیات هر فرمان است. پس از اجرا، صفحهٔ مستندات در یک محیط مشابه less باز میشود که میتوانید آن را با کلیدهای جهت یا فاصله ورق بزنید و با q خارج شوید.
$ man cp
ساختار صفحهٔ man معمولاً شامل بخشهای NAME، SYNOPSIS، DESCRIPTION و مثالها است. به یاد داشته باشید که برخی برنامهها در بخش SEE ALSO به ابزارهای مرتبط اشاره میکنند که برای گسترش دانش بسیار مفید است.
کمک سریع با گزینهٔ --help
بسیاری از فرمانها با گزینهٔ --help یا -h خلاصهای از کاربردها و گزینهها را چاپ میکنند. این خروجی برای مرور سریع مناسب است و معمولاً در ترمینال جاری ظاهر میشود.
$ cp --help
این روش زمانی مفید است که فقط به دنبال گزینهٔ خاصی هستید و نمیخواهید صفحهٔ بلند man را کامل مطالعه کنید.
مستندات GNU با info
برخی ابزارها راهنمای تکمیلی خود را در قالب info ارائه میدهند. این محیط مشابه یک درخت موضوعی عمل میکند و با کلیدهای جهت یا دستوراتی مثل n (بعدی)، p (قبلی) و u (بازگشت به سطح بالاتر) کار میکند.
$ info coreutils 'cp invocation'
اگر تازه با info آشنا میشوید، با اجرای info info راهنمای استفاده از این سیستم را مطالعه کنید.
یافتن دستوراتی که نام دقیقشان را نمیدانید
apropos KEYWORD: فهرست صفحات راهنمایی که کلمهٔ مورد نظر در توضیح آنها آمده است.$ apropos archiveman -k KEYWORD: مخفف همانaproposاست و نتیجهٔ مشابهی میدهد.- جستوجو در اینترنت و خواندن مثالهای عملی از وبسایتهایی مانند TLDR Pages یا ExplainShell میتواند زمان یادگیری را کاهش دهد؛ فقط مطمئن شوید که دستورات به سیستم شما آسیب نمیزنند.
عادتهای یادگیری مؤثر
- هنگام مطالعهٔ هر دستور، چند مثال عملی بنویسید و فوراً اجرا کنید.
- یادداشتهای شخصی از گزینههای مهم یا خطاهای متداول تهیه کنید تا در پروژههای بعدی سریعتر به نتیجه برسید.
- در جلسات ترمینالی تمرینی، با استفاده از کلید
↑(تاریخچه) فرمانهای قبلی را بازبینی کنید تا الگوهای تکراری را به خاطر بسپارید.